1 THE PRIVATE AFFAIRS OF public PENSIONS IN SOUTH AFRICA DEBT, DEVELOPMENT AND CORPORATIZATION1 Fred Hendricks Faculty of Humanities Rhodes University Grahamstown SOUTH AFRICA We are limited in SOUTH AFRICA because our democratic Government inherited a debt which at the time we were servicing at the rate of 30 billion rand a year. That is thirty billion we did not have to build houses, to make sure our children go to the best schools, and to ensure that everybody has the dignity of having a job and a decent in-come. Nelson Mandela (ACTSA 2002) The first charge against government revenue is interest on government debt. The big-ger our deficit, the more we have to borrow, the higher the interest bill and the less money there is available to invest in social development, in poverty relief and in the development of our human resources. Trevor Manuel, Finance Minister (1997) The bulk of our debt is the domestic debt of ordinary SOUTH Africans through the pub-lic pension funds.
